Bio-Functional Potential and Biochemical Properties of Propolis Collected from Different Regions of Balochistan Province of Pakistan
Table 4
Fourier Transform infrared analysis of propolis extract.
| Range (cmā1) | Type of signal | Type of link | Main attribution |
| 3740-3550 | Elongation | O-H and N-H | Hydroxyls and amino acids | 3366-3333 | Stretching | O-H | Phenolic groups | 3000-3200 | Stretching | C-H, aromatics | Flavonoids and aromatic rings | 2971-2830 and 2730-2066 | Elongation symmetric and asymmetric | C-H | Hydrocarbons | 1699-1610 | Asymmetric bending vibrations | C=O | Lipids, flavonoids and amino acids | 1560-1505 | Elongation | C=C, aromatics | Flavonoids and aromatic rings | 1450-1415 | Bending vibrations | C-H, C-H2 and C-H3 | Flavonoids and aromatic rings | 1399-1310 | Bending vibration | C-H | CH3 group of flavonoids | 1232-1200 | Bending vibration (O-H) and asymmetrically bending (C-CO) | O-H and C-CO | Hydrocarbons | 1198-1000 | Stretching vibration (C-C) and bending (C-OH) | C-C and C-OH | Flavonoids and secondary alcohol groups |
